Special Committee on Covid-19 Response
Briefing by Department of Health Officials
Dr. Tony Holohan:
It is public health advice. It relates to our assessment in relation to the potential incubation period of this virus. There is pretty much international consensus on 14 days. Few countries are at variance with that particular measure. It is to try and ensure that we limit travel from overseas and have people coming in who do not spend a period of time. The reason it does not exist for travel on the island is that our assessment is that, in broad terms, the island is behaving as one from a disease point of view. In Northern Ireland, the incidence is broadly similar.
